Uses of Class
net.minecraft.client.texture.Sprite
Packages that use Sprite
Package
Description
-
Uses of Sprite in net.minecraft.client
Methods in net.minecraft.client that return types with arguments of type Sprite -
Uses of Sprite in net.minecraft.client.gui
Methods in net.minecraft.client.gui with parameters of type SpriteModifier and TypeMethodDescriptionvoidDrawContext.drawSprite(int x, int y, int z, int width, int height, Sprite sprite) voidDrawContext.drawSprite(int x, int y, int z, int width, int height, Sprite sprite, float red, float green, float blue, float alpha) -
Uses of Sprite in net.minecraft.client.gui.hud
Methods in net.minecraft.client.gui.hud with parameters of type SpriteModifier and TypeMethodDescriptionprivate static voidInGameOverlayRenderer.renderInWallOverlay(Sprite sprite, MatrixStack matrices) -
Uses of Sprite in net.minecraft.client.gui.screen.ingame
Fields in net.minecraft.client.gui.screen.ingame declared as Sprite -
Uses of Sprite in net.minecraft.client.particle
Fields in net.minecraft.client.particle declared as SpriteFields in net.minecraft.client.particle with type parameters of type SpriteMethods in net.minecraft.client.particle that return SpriteModifier and TypeMethodDescriptionParticleManager.SimpleSpriteProvider.getSprite(int age, int maxAge) SpriteProvider.getSprite(int age, int maxAge) Methods in net.minecraft.client.particle with parameters of type SpriteMethod parameters in net.minecraft.client.particle with type arguments of type SpriteModifier and TypeMethodDescriptionvoidParticleManager.SimpleSpriteProvider.setSprites(List<Sprite> sprites) -
Uses of Sprite in net.minecraft.client.render
Fields in net.minecraft.client.render declared as SpriteConstructors in net.minecraft.client.render with parameters of type SpriteModifierConstructorDescriptionSpriteTexturedVertexConsumer(VertexConsumer delegate, Sprite sprite) -
Uses of Sprite in net.minecraft.client.render.block
Fields in net.minecraft.client.render.block declared as SpriteModifier and TypeFieldDescriptionprivate final Sprite[]FluidRenderer.lavaSpritesprivate SpriteFluidRenderer.waterOverlaySpriteprivate final Sprite[]FluidRenderer.waterSpritesMethods in net.minecraft.client.render.block that return Sprite -
Uses of Sprite in net.minecraft.client.render.entity
Methods in net.minecraft.client.render.entity with parameters of type SpriteModifier and TypeMethodDescriptionprivate voidPaintingEntityRenderer.renderPainting(MatrixStack matrices, VertexConsumer vertexConsumer, PaintingEntity entity, int width, int height, Sprite paintingSprite, Sprite backSprite) -
Uses of Sprite in net.minecraft.client.render.model
Fields in net.minecraft.client.render.model declared as SpriteModifier and TypeFieldDescriptionprivate SpriteBasicBakedModel.Builder.particleTextureprotected final SpriteBakedQuad.spriteprotected final SpriteBasicBakedModel.spriteprivate final SpriteBuiltinBakedModel.spriteprotected final SpriteMultipartBakedModel.spriteFields in net.minecraft.client.render.model with type parameters of type SpriteModifier and TypeFieldDescriptionprivate final Function<SpriteIdentifier,Sprite> ModelLoader.BakerImpl.textureGetterMethods in net.minecraft.client.render.model that return SpriteModifier and TypeMethodDescriptionSpriteAtlasManager.AtlasPreparation.getMissingSprite()BakedModel.getParticleSprite()Returns a texture that represents the model.BasicBakedModel.getParticleSprite()Returns a texture that represents the model.BuiltinBakedModel.getParticleSprite()Returns a texture that represents the model.MultipartBakedModel.getParticleSprite()Returns a texture that represents the model.WeightedBakedModel.getParticleSprite()Returns a texture that represents the model.BakedQuad.getSprite()SpriteAtlasManager.AtlasPreparation.getSprite(Identifier id) Methods in net.minecraft.client.render.model with parameters of type SpriteModifier and TypeMethodDescriptionBakedQuadFactory.bake(Vector3f from, Vector3f to, ModelElementFace face, Sprite texture, Direction side, ModelBakeSettings settings, @Nullable ModelRotation rotation, boolean shade, Identifier modelId) private voidBakedQuadFactory.packVertexData(int[] vertices, int cornerIndex, Direction direction, ModelElementTexture texture, float[] positionMatrix, Sprite sprite, AffineTransformation orientation, @Nullable ModelRotation rotation, boolean shaded) private voidBakedQuadFactory.packVertexData(int[] vertices, int cornerIndex, Vector3f position, Sprite sprite, ModelElementTexture modelElementTexture) private int[]BakedQuadFactory.packVertexData(ModelElementTexture texture, Sprite sprite, Direction direction, float[] positionMatrix, AffineTransformation orientation, @Nullable ModelRotation rotation, boolean shaded) BasicBakedModel.Builder.setParticle(Sprite sprite) Method parameters in net.minecraft.client.render.model with type arguments of type SpriteModifier and TypeMethodDescriptionvoidModelLoader.bake(BiFunction<Identifier, SpriteIdentifier, Sprite> spriteLoader) MultipartUnbakedModel.bake(Baker baker, Function<SpriteIdentifier, Sprite> textureGetter, ModelBakeSettings rotationContainer, Identifier modelId) UnbakedModel.bake(Baker baker, Function<SpriteIdentifier, Sprite> textureGetter, ModelBakeSettings rotationContainer, Identifier modelId) Constructors in net.minecraft.client.render.model with parameters of type SpriteModifierConstructorDescriptionBasicBakedModel(List<BakedQuad> quads, Map<Direction, List<BakedQuad>> faceQuads, boolean usesAo, boolean isSideLit, boolean hasDepth, Sprite sprite, ModelTransformation transformation, ModelOverrideList itemPropertyOverrides) BuiltinBakedModel(ModelTransformation transformation, ModelOverrideList itemPropertyOverrides, Sprite sprite, boolean sideLit) Constructor parameters in net.minecraft.client.render.model with type arguments of type SpriteModifierConstructorDescription(package private)BakerImpl(BiFunction<Identifier, SpriteIdentifier, Sprite> spriteLoader, Identifier modelId) -
Uses of Sprite in net.minecraft.client.render.model.json
Methods in net.minecraft.client.render.model.json with parameters of type SpriteModifier and TypeMethodDescriptionprivate static BakedQuadJsonUnbakedModel.createQuad(ModelElement element, ModelElementFace elementFace, Sprite sprite, Direction side, ModelBakeSettings settings, Identifier id) Method parameters in net.minecraft.client.render.model.json with type arguments of type SpriteModifier and TypeMethodDescriptionJsonUnbakedModel.bake(Baker baker, Function<SpriteIdentifier, Sprite> textureGetter, ModelBakeSettings rotationContainer, Identifier modelId) JsonUnbakedModel.bake(Baker baker, JsonUnbakedModel parent, Function<SpriteIdentifier, Sprite> textureGetter, ModelBakeSettings settings, Identifier id, boolean hasDepth) WeightedUnbakedModel.bake(Baker baker, Function<SpriteIdentifier, Sprite> textureGetter, ModelBakeSettings rotationContainer, Identifier modelId) ItemModelGenerator.create(Function<SpriteIdentifier, Sprite> textureGetter, JsonUnbakedModel blockModel) -
Uses of Sprite in net.minecraft.client.texture
Fields in net.minecraft.client.texture declared as SpriteModifier and TypeFieldDescriptionprivate final SpriteSpriteLoader.StitchResult.missingThe field for themissingrecord component.Fields in net.minecraft.client.texture with type parameters of type SpriteModifier and TypeFieldDescriptionprivate final Map<Identifier,Sprite> SpriteLoader.StitchResult.regionsThe field for theregionsrecord component.private Map<Identifier,Sprite> SpriteAtlasTexture.spritesMethods in net.minecraft.client.texture that return SpriteModifier and TypeMethodDescriptionPaintingManager.getBackSprite()PaintingManager.getPaintingSprite(PaintingVariant variant) protected SpriteSpriteAtlasHolder.getSprite(Identifier objectId) SpriteAtlasTexture.getSprite(Identifier id) StatusEffectSpriteManager.getSprite(StatusEffect effect) SpriteLoader.StitchResult.missing()Returns the value of themissingrecord component.Methods in net.minecraft.client.texture that return types with arguments of type SpriteModifier and TypeMethodDescriptionprivate Map<Identifier,Sprite> SpriteLoader.collectStitchedSprites(TextureStitcher<SpriteContents> stitcher, int atlasWidth, int atlasHeight) SpriteLoader.StitchResult.regions()Returns the value of theregionsrecord component.Method parameters in net.minecraft.client.texture with type arguments of type SpriteModifier and TypeMethodDescriptionprivate static voidSpriteAtlasTexture.dumpAtlasInfos(Path path, String id, Map<Identifier, Sprite> sprites) Constructors in net.minecraft.client.texture with parameters of type SpriteModifierConstructorDescriptionStitchResult(int int2, int int3, int int4, Sprite sprite, Map<Identifier, Sprite> map, CompletableFuture<Void> completableFuture) Constructor parameters in net.minecraft.client.texture with type arguments of type SpriteModifierConstructorDescriptionStitchResult(int int2, int int3, int int4, Sprite sprite, Map<Identifier, Sprite> map, CompletableFuture<Void> completableFuture) -
Uses of Sprite in net.minecraft.client.util
Methods in net.minecraft.client.util that return Sprite